5-Norbornene-2-carboxylic acid; CAS No.: 10138-32-6; 5-Norbornene-2-carboxylic acid. PROPERTIES: This norbornene-substituted carboxylic acid features molecular formula C?H?O? with molecular weight 124.14 g/mol. It generally appears as a white crystalline powder. Soluble in polar aprotic solvents like DMF and DMSO. Melting point approximately 100-105 C. Exhibits IR absorption for carboxylic acid (~2900-2500 cm??) and norbornene ring stretches. Thermogravimetric analysis indicates decomposition above 180 C under nitrogen. For optimal stability, store at 2-8 C in tightly sealed containers with desiccant, protected from light. The compound may cause mild skin irritation and serious eye damage; therefore, standard laboratory safety precautions including protective clothing and eye protection are recommended during handling. APPLICATIONS: As a norbornene-substituted carboxylic acid, 5-Norbornene-2-carboxylic acid is predominantly utilized in the synthesis of polymerizable monomers. It serves as a key intermediate in constructing norbornene-based polymers, where the norbornene ring provides valuable crosslinking sites for forming thermoset materials as demonstrated in polymer chemistry research (Macromolecules). Additionally, the compound participates in the development of fluorescent probes for bioimaging applications, where its carboxylic acid functionality enables conjugation to biomolecules via amide bond formation (Bioconjugate Chemistry). In materials science, it functions as a monomer for preparing polyurethane foams with enhanced thermal stability, where the norbornene ring contributes to improved mechanical properties (Polymer International).
